0
こんにちは、私は新しい作成プラグイン(mpc)を使ってpom(scm area)のいくつかの部分をチェックしています...しかし、今、私はmvnリリースでそれに直面しました。私はMavenプラグイン - mvnリリース:prepare
が[INFO] [INFO] Scanning the projects...
[INFO] [INFO] ...
[INFO] [INFO] not a working copy....
私はSVN情報の出力をチェックしてるので「ない作業コピーは」...です... 質問が出力されます
ことができます。私は次のメッセージを持って作成されたプラグイン(MPC)を使用していますmvnのリリース中にこの状態を記録する:どうにかして準備する?たとえば、現在のプロジェクトの属性を調べたり、言い換えれば、私は現在のリリース:準備サイクルが実行されている私のmavenプラグイン(mpc)の中に知っていることを意味しますか?
解決策が見つかりました。現在のビルドがSNAPSHOTバージョンを構築しているかどうかを確認するだけです(ArtifactUtil.isSnapshot()が非常に役に立ちます)。 – khmarbaise
解決策を回答として投稿し、最良の回答として選択してください。 – yegor256